Anatomic kinesiology is the study of how the body's structures and tissues function during movement. It involves analyzing the mechanics, forces, and coordination of muscles, joints, and bones in various activities. This field is often used in physical therapy, sports science, and biomechanics to improve performance, prevent injuries, and enhance rehabilitation.

What does the prefix kinesi as in kinesiology mean?

The prefix "kinesi-" in kinesiology is derived from the Greek word "kinesis," which means movement. In the field of kinesiology, the study focuses on the mechanics and anatomy of human movement.
